Are hybrid tomatoes blight resistant?

There are a number of hybrid tomatoes bred to resist blight and other diseases. Johnny's Selected Seeds teamed up with North Carolina State University to breed Defiant PHR, a midsize determinate tomato that is highly resistant to all strains of early and late blights.

What tomatoes are resistant to late blight?

'Mountain Magic', 'Mountain Merit', 'Legend', 'Defiant PHR' and 'Plum Regal' have excellent resistance to Late Blight. 'Jasper', 'Red Pearl' and 'Matt's Wild Cherry' are small fruited tomatoes with good resistance. Some heirloom tomato varieties have good tolerance to late blight.

Are cherry tomatoes blight resistant?

Matt's Wild Cherry Tomato – this tomato variety is resistant to both early and late blight. The plants are indeterminate. The fruit weighs 5 grams (less than 1 ounce), maturing in 60 days.

Are San Marzano tomatoes disease resistant?

San Marzano tomato plants have historically been sensitive to disease, and in the 1970s they were almost wiped out by the cucumber mosaic virus in the Naples area. Today hybrid varieties provide some level of resistance to common diseases like verticillium and fusarium wilt.

Does tomato blight stay in the soil?

Blight cannot survive in soil or fully composted plant material. It over-winters in living plant material and is spread on the wind the following year. The most common way to allow blight to remain in your garden is through 'volunteer potatoes'.

Which tomato variety is resistant to bacterial wilt?

One of the well-known BW-resistant tomato cultivars is Hawaii 7996, which exerts the most stable resistance against R. solanacearum infection by several major and minor quantitative trait loci (QTL) (Thoquet et al., 1996; Wang et al., 1998).

What is the difference between Roma and San Marzano tomatoes?

Description. Compared to the Roma tomato, San Marzano tomatoes are thinner and more pointed. The flesh is much thicker with fewer seeds, and the taste is stronger, sweeter, and less acidic.

What makes San Marzano tomatoes so special?

Are San Marzano tomatoes the best? These tomatoes have a huge reputation and boast a Protected Designation of Origin status (DOP, or sometimes written as PDO - Denominazione d'Origine Protetta) which specifies the precise cultivar, processing method and region in which the tomatoes can be grown.
